Transaction 77dfb653b9116486a914d014746cfe495d3a5a67593e5ebcfc6f8fcd2fb9d08b

1 Input
2 Outputs
  • 77dfb653b9116486a914d014746cfe495d3a5a67593e5ebcfc6f8fcd2fb9d08b:0
  • value  231396
    address  38ZHUbWNbbCKiX7Air8pQS5gShBamyTpkh
  • 77dfb653b9116486a914d014746cfe495d3a5a67593e5ebcfc6f8fcd2fb9d08b:1
  • value  17390117
    address  3GhHx1WFSeoE3HMabWqCiZH9s1HXdUAEFC